Upgrades Underway For WSU Dairy

Work to upgrade Washington State University’s Knott Dairy Center outside Pullman is underway. The Washington Legislature recently allocated 10 million dollars to improve the 60 year old dairy West of town.  The work includes a new barn, better drainage and manure handling improvements.  The farm is home to 160 cows […]
